Listen to Black American Melissa C. Potter — born in Jamaica, Queens, raised in Rockland County, New York, and residing in Westchester County — share about pivoting into social impact and strategy work in TV from the music industry. She shares about how the 2020 Q3 and Q4 was a gift and curse for a lot successful professional Black folks where companies were scrambling to hire heads of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ion and Social Impact. She also talks about buying a home during the pandemic when interest rates were very low.

Prior to the pandemic, “On the work front much of the work that I did was in person: hosting film screenings and panel discussions; so, it was all hands-on deck, very high stress, figuring out how to adapt this in-person company model to a virtual space.” Melissa recalls.
